Correct Ventilation
Whether you have an outdoor tents range that comes pre-installed or determine to install it yourself, correct ventilation is vital for your safety. Oven jacks give a closed air vent that permits warm and smoke to leave your camping tent, while likewise preventing carbon monoxide from accumulating inside. They must be positioned above the ridge of your camping tent and far from other equipment or combustible materials to reduce triggers or fire hazards.

Furthermore, a safe distance in between your stove and the walls of your outdoor tents will permit sufficient air movement. You can avoid drafts by safeguarding your range jack with a wind flap and making certain that your flue pipe isn't obstructed.

Outdoors tents made from synthetic textiles are not made to house an oven, which places you at a raised risk of fire or carbon monoxide poisoning. Buy a canvas camping tent with a heat-resistant stove jack to remain risk-free when camping. A fly cover can also be a great addition, producing one more layer of defense between your outdoor tents and any sparks or getting away fumes from the stove.

Stimulate Arrestors
A stimulate arrestor is an essential accessory for wood-burning camping tent ovens. This tool avoids stimulates and embers from running away the chimney and reaching combustible materials within the outdoor tents, such as sleeping bags or walls.

It is necessary to select a spark arrestor that works with your details stove and flue size. You also intend to make sure that it's easy to mount and secure throughout use. Routine cleansing is advised to guarantee that the gadget isn't obstructed with residue and creosote.

Ultimately, a trigger arrestor also safeguards the atmosphere by lessening the threat of wildfires. This is particularly crucial because lots of national forests and outdoor camping areas require their use to avoid endangering natural surroundings and wild animals.

Storm Flaps
When you're camping, any type of void between your outdoor tents and the oven pipeline is a fire threat. It allows air, rain, snow, insects and cinders to get in the tent, which can fire up flammable products or cause carbon monoxide gas poisoning. This is why it's vital to make use of tornado flaps that shut out these aspects.

The ideal flaps are made from heat-resistant materials and include a hollow design that maximizes ventilation while preserving safety and security. They can be attached to the chimney opening of your outdoor tents and are very easy to install. They likewise give a protected, flame-resistant obstacle that protects against accidental fires and makes sure a secure environment for you and your loved ones.

Furthermore, you must maintain flammable products far from your stove. This includes things like alcohol, spray can and gas cyndrical tubes. Maintaining these products safely stored beyond your camping tent will certainly additionally minimize the danger of fires triggered by your range. You should additionally make certain to keep a fire extinguisher nearby in case of emergency situation.
